Enroll a Child

Every child can benefit from having another caring adult in his/her life. Mentors help children broaden their horizons by sharing time with them. Children can meet with their mentors on weekends, during their school day, or after-school.

Community Based Program

This program provides Ozaukee County youth between the ages of 5 through 15, with the opportunity to develop a special friendship with another caring adult. The ‘new friends’ spend an average of 3 hours together 2-3 times per month exploring interests, sharing stories, and enjoying the experience of being together.

Activity Ideas

Activities the matches participate in are focused around the child and volunteer’s interests. The possibilities are endless. To name a few…Playing sports, going to a museum, attending family gatherings, biking, watching movies, cooking, doing arts and crafts, and hiking.

The Rewards

Both the volunteer and child share in receiving the benefits of this magical friendship. They learn from each other the importance of having fun, trying new things, developing friendships, cherishing life’s simple moments, laughing at yourself, and learning to relax and take life a little less seriously.
